Judge in Bill Cosby trial warns jury
The judge in Bill Cosby’s sexual assault trial has opened proceedings by warning the jury not to read news updates about the case on their phones.
The 79-year-old is accused of giving university employee Andrea Constand drugs and then sexually assaulting her in 2004, in the only criminal case to emerge from dozens of allegations lodged against the actor.
The jury for the trial, which began yesterday in Norristown, Philadelphia, is sequestered at a nearby hotel for the duration of the two-week case.
